*** We need to build a roster of available operators for our HF stations.  We will have the two SSB stations sheltered and I don't expect dreadful temps for the outdoor stations.  


1. SSB#1    20/15m SSB host=KB3WAV, yagi from Ray and I think a rig from Pete  (K3)
2. SSB#2    40/80m SSB host=KB3VWK, wires from Ray, rig=TBD

3. 20/80m CW N3SB
4. 10m SSB/CW, 40/15m CW host=W3JJH     (will integrate solar)


+ N3VOP VHF
+ N8PK satellite
+ KF3AK/KB3QMO traffic and training


KEY THEME -- Flexible Rapid Timely Deployment.  we have no other choice!  
we are sharing the site with a flea market saturday morning that will 
linger into the early afternoon.  Our club trustee Andy has directed we 
not attempt any setup prior to 9 am saturday, and even this appears 
questionable we can do much.  


Suggested Optional Concept --  origin is osmosis from much club discussion!  very easy now with 4A


mitigate 20m co-site QRM

- start KB3WAV station on 15m if we have some propagation, transition later to 20m
- start N3SB station on 20m, transition to 80m opposite of Kerri (and maybe even use 10m if there is propagation)


N1MM is preferred logging package that all 4 of us are using, it allows operators to not need training for each rig.
